Post by msg_dman »

You need to think about what you really want. If you want to be a Ranger as badly as you say, then ROTC is the wrong route to be taking. After 4 years of college, you will be put in the branch they want you in. It may be one that you do not want, and may keep you from ever even attending Ranger school, let alone ever getting into a Battalion some day.

I am not bashing ROTC, but I saw my share of hard charging MS4's who were crushed when they found out they were branched Chemical or Transportation mid way through their senior year.
